FAQs on Cinjoy 25mg Tablet

Drowsiness is a common side effect of Cinjoy 25mg Tablets, particularly when you first start taking them. Avoid driving or operating machinery if you experience excessive sleepiness.
Cinjoy 25mg tablets help manage tinnitus, a condition causing the perception of sounds originating within the body, not from external sources. This is often a symptom of an underlying medical condition, such as Ménière's disease.
For motion sickness prevention, adults and children over 12 years old may take two 25mg Cinjoy tablets two hours before travel. During travel, one tablet may be taken every eight hours as needed. Children aged 5-12 years should take one tablet two hours before travel, with an additional half-tablet every eight hours during travel if necessary.
Cinjoy 25mg Tablets may worsen motor function in Parkinson's disease patients, necessitating avoidance. While reversible, this effect can persist for days. Furthermore, it may trigger Parkinsonian syndrome in older individuals, requiring cautious use.
Taking too many Cinjoy 25mg Tablets can lead to nausea, vomiting, stomach upset, tremors, uncontrolled muscle spasms, muscle weakness, drowsiness, or decreased consciousness. Young children might also have seizures. Seek immediate medical attention if an overdose occurs, whether accidental or intentional.
Cinjoy 25mg Tablets are not intended for long-term use except in older patients with vertigo, under strict medical supervision. Prolonged unsupervised use carries a significant risk of irreversible extrapyramidal side effects, such as Parkinsonism.
